The UAE isn’t just Dubai and Abu Dhabi—it’s a network of cities with universities that partner with top global schools like NYU Abu Dhabi, American University of Sharjah, and Khalifa University. Many of these institutions offer degrees that are recognized worldwide, and most programs are taught in English, making the transition easier for Indian students.

Also known as UAE student visa, it’s typically tied to your enrollment and allows part-time work, which many students use to cover living costs. Unlike countries with strict post-study work limits, the UAE offers a two-year grace period after graduation to find a job, giving you real time to build a career. And because the UAE has no income tax, your take-home pay after landing a job is higher than in many Western countries. Many Indian students choose the UAE because it’s culturally closer than the US or UK—food, language, and even the pace of life feel familiar. Plus, flights from India are short, cheap, and frequent.
It’s not all smooth sailing. You’ll need to prepare for cultural adjustments, especially around dress codes and public behavior. Some campuses are more relaxed than others, but it’s still important to know the rules. Also, while tuition is lower than in the US, living costs in Dubai and Abu Dhabi can add up fast—rent, transport, and groceries aren’t cheap. But if you’re smart about budgeting and pick the right university, you can graduate with a globally respected degree and little to no debt.
